Отправляет email-рассылки с помощью сервиса Sendsay

Зловредный Апач-II

i686-pc-linux-gnu)

Скачал в исходниках:
httpd-2.0.52
mySQL-4.0.21
php-4.3.9

хочу скрестить апач с php, в инструкции по установке php (/usr/src/php-4.3.9/INSTALL)
есть рекомендации по "сдруживанию" =) его с апачем,
вот кусок:
cd /apache_sources/
./configure --enable-so
make
make install

а apache не хочет собираться с поддрежкой DSO, говроит при ./configure следующее:
/cut/
Checking for DSO...
checking for NSLinkModule... no
checking for shl_load in -ldld... no
checking for dlopen... no
checking for dlopen in -ldl... yes
adding "-ldl" to LIBS
checking for dlsym... yes
/cut/

из-за этого он собирается без поддержки DSO - > PHPшный configure не видит этой
поддержки в апаче -> шиш, а не libphp4.so в итоге :(

ВОПРОС: как врубить поддержку DSO (а ведь она есть, иначе как всё остальное-то
работатет)

ЗЫ че делать, хз, порылся в инете, нашел доки ~2000 года на эту тему - там вообще
все по другому

ЗЗЫ пытался собрать на RedHat9, Slackware9.1

ЗЗЗЫ [offtop] настоящему апачу завсегда везде ништяк - заколотит трубку мира...
(с) Песня

Ответить   Tue, 12 Oct 2004 14:45:13 +0400 (#243838)

 

Ответы:

Nick (iMp) Mikhaylov wrote:

Можно же ещё php прикрутить как CGI, тогда libphp4.so не нужен, нужен
бинарник php...

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 12182; Возраст листа: 445; Участников: 1279
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/244067



-*Информационный канал Subscribe.Ru
Подписан адрес:
Код этой рассылки: comp.soft.linux.discuss
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ru?subject=comp.soft.linux.discuss

http://subscribe.ru/ http://subscribe.ru/feedback

Ответить   SiRex Wed, 13 Oct 2004 10:36:31 +0300 (#244067)

 

On Tue, 12 Oct 2004 14:45:13 +0400
Nick (iMp) Mikhaylov <m4@m*****.ru> wrote:

поставить нормальный отлаженный Апач 1.3.x

это достаточно кривой workaround, а не решение проблемы с апачем.

Ответить   Antony Dovgal Wed, 13 Oct 2004 16:59:32 +0400 (#244232)

 

i686-pc-linux-gnu)

На часах было Wed, 13 Oct 2004 16:59:32 +0400,
когда Antony Dovgal <tony20***@p*****.net> написал следующее:

Как все сложно :-0. С шапкой9, кста 2.0.[кажется 50] идет, а тут во оно как (где-то
уже слышал, что пользование апачем 2.х.х. пока относится к извращениям)...

Попробую...

Ответить   Wed, 13 Oct 2004 19:18:58 +0400 (#244431)

 

Wed, 13 Oct 2004 16:59:32 +0400
Antony Dovgal <tony20***@p*****.net> написал:

(кто б мне сказал, откуда это убеждённость о
невозможности подружить PHP и Apache 2?)

При сборке PHP нужно добавить --with-apxs2
для configure. Соотв. у апача должен быть этот
самый apxs, но особых телодвижений для этого
вроде делать не надо.

Проверялось на apache 2.0.50 и php 4.3.4

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 12474; Возраст листа: 450; Участников: 1274
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/246789



-*Информационный канал Subscribe.Ru
Подписан адрес:
Код этой рассылки: comp.soft.linux.discuss
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ru?subject=comp.soft.linux.discuss

http://subscribe.ru/ http://subscribe.ru/feedback

Ответить   Alex Suykov Mon, 18 Oct 2004 10:35:37 +0300 (#246789)

 

On Mon, 18 Oct 2004 10:35:37 +0300
Alex Suykov <sca***@m*****.com> wrote:

я сказал невозможность?
я имел ввиду нежелательность.

Do not use Apache 2.0.x and PHP in a production environment neither
on Unix nor on Windows. For information on why, read the following
FAQ entry.

(c) http://www.php.net/manual/en/install.unix.apache2.php

ага, научите его плохому, научите =)

Ответить   Antony Dovgal Mon, 18 Oct 2004 16:00:05 +0400 (#246792)

 

i686-pc-linux-gnu)

На часах было Mon, 18 Oct 2004 16:00:05 +0400,
когда Antony Dovgal <tony20***@p*****.net> написал следующее:

да не, я ужо 1.3.31 скачал, поставил

ксати без проблем установился и подружился с php,
так что все нормально, пасиба всем откликнувшимя!

Ответить   Mon, 18 Oct 2004 21:02:52 +0400 (#246983)

 

Mon, 18 Oct 2004 16:00:05 +0400
Antony Dovgal <tony20***@p*****.net> написал:

хм... действительно, я малось ошибся.

Нда... хреновенько.
А в исходниках вроде никаких предупреждений нет,
кроме рекомендации сходить по это ссылке за up-to-date
support status info...

...

:)
Ну, он не сказал, что его система является production
environment. Зато сказал, что там уже есть apache 2.0.x.

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 12511; Возраст листа: 451; Участников: 1274
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/247220



-*Информационный канал Subscribe.Ru
Подписан адрес:
Код этой рассылки: comp.soft.linux.discuss
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ru?subject=comp.soft.linux.discuss

http://subscribe.ru/ http://subscribe.ru/feedback

Ответить   Alex Suykov Tue, 19 Oct 2004 08:33:42 +0300 (#247220)

 

i686-pc-linux-gnu)

На часах было Tue, 19 Oct 2004 08:33:42 +0300,
когда Alex Suykov <sca***@m*****.com> написал следующее:

??? дык стандартно с RedHat9 идет (2.0.40-21)

Ответить   Tue, 19 Oct 2004 23:14:33 +0400 (#247629)

 

i686-pc-linux-gnu)

On Tue, 19 Oct 2004 23:14:33 +0400
Nick (iMp) Mikhaylov <m4@m*****.ru> wrote:


RH8, RH9, FC1 у меня без проблем работали с "родными" апачем и php.

--

С наилучшими пожеланиями
Крохин Анатолий (kraw)
icq 20060869

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 12549; Возраст листа: 452; Участников: 1274
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/247811



-*Информационный канал Subscribe.Ru
Подписан адрес:
Код этой рассылки: comp.soft.linux.discuss
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ru?subject=comp.soft.linux.discuss

http://subscribe.ru/ http://subscribe.ru/feedback

Ответить   Крохин Анатолий Александрович Wed, 20 Oct 2004 10:23:21 +0400 (#247811)

 

На часах было Wed, 20 Oct 2004 10:23:21 +0400,
когда Крохин Анатолий Александрович <kr***@b*****.ru> написал следующее:

дык про "родные" версии никто ничего не говорит - нормально работали (кроме одной
проблемы с апачем [Зловредный Апач-I, см. в архивах рассылки] ), только вот оправдано-ли
из сображений безопасности работать на устаревших версиях??? (вспоминается RH
7.3, wu-ftp и ramen =) )

Ответить   Thu, 21 Oct 2004 00:03:18 +0400 (#248220)

 

i686-pc-linux-gnu)

On Thu, 21 Oct 2004 00:03:18 +0400
Nick (iMp) Mikhaylov <m4@m*****.ru> wrote:


В моем случае оправдано - живет исключительно в локальной сети и "just
for fun". Поэтому нет проблемы безопасности.



--

С наилучшими пожеланиями
Крохин Анатолий (kraw)
icq 20060869

-*Название листа "Linux: разрешение вопросов, перспективы и общение";
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Адрес правил листа http://subscribe.ru/catalog/comp.soft.linux.discuss/rules
Номер письма: 12593; Возраст листа: 453; Участников: 1275
Адрес сайта рассылки: http://www.linuxrsp.ru
Адрес этого письма в архиве: http://subscribe.ru/archive/comp.soft.linux.discuss/msg/248366



-*Информационный канал Subscribe.Ru
Подписан адрес:
Код этой рассылки: comp.soft.linux.discuss
Написать в лист: mailto:comp.soft.linux.discuss-list@subscribe.ru
Отписаться: mailto:comp.soft.linux.discuss--unsub@subscribe.ru?subject=comp.soft.linux.discuss

http://subscribe.ru/ http://subscribe.ru/feedback

Ответить   Крохин Анатолий Алек сандрович Thu, 21 Oct 2004 10:15:48 +0400 (#248366)